The ingredients needed to make Lebanese Zucchini with Yoghurt Sauce (Kousa billaban):
  1. 1 kg Lebanese zucchini (choose the small or medium ones)
  2. 1/2 kg mince beef
  3. 1 cup medium grain rice
  4. 1 tsp salt
  5. 1/2 tsp pepper
  6. Yoghurt sauce:
  7. 3 cups Greek yoghurt
  8. 1 tsp mint flake
  9. 1 tsp oregano flake
  10. 1 tsp salt
  11. 3 garlic cloves (finely chopped)
  12. 3 cups water

Steps to make Lebanese Zucchini with Yoghurt Sauce (Kousa billaban):
  1. Using the corer knife, core the zucchini core to make it ready to be stuffed. Put aside.
  2. Preheat pan, cook mince beef without oil until well cooked, put aside.
  3. Wash medium grain rice in a bowl, add cooked mince beef salt, and peper. mix well.
  4. Stuff rice and mince beef into zucchinis, put aside.
  5. Prepare large cooking pot, put yoghurt and water, mix them well. Put the pot on the medium heat, keep stiring the yoghurt until it boils properly.
  6. Add chopped garlic, stuffed Lebanese zucchinis, and salt, lower the heat, cover the pot. Wait until the zucchinis and rice inside them cook really well.
  7. When they all cooked and soft, sprinkle mint flake and oregano, mix occasionally.
  8. It's ready to serve.
